Chesspark Raises $1 Million

A chess game Web 2.0 site Chesspark has raised $1 million. Angel investors include Jon Callaghan of True Ventures, Burnt Norton, Inc. and Eaglebrook School. According to Chesspark, they will use the fund for the purpose of completing the beta tests of their online chess game. Chesspark, launched in October last year, their goal is to provide the best chess playing experience on the Web and currently there are more than 100,000 users enrolled in this Web 2.0 site. The co-founder of Chesspark Brian Zisk is a serial entrepreneur and in matter of fact, he is also a Board Member and/or Strategic Advisor for several tech companies and non-profits, including the Metabrainz Foundation creators of MusicBrainz, the Xiph Foundation creators of Open Source Audio and Video technologies including Icecast, Vorbis, FLAC, and Theora, Clickfacts, Inc., Rightround/Bandbot, Kiptronic, Inc., Gotuit Media, and more.

At this moment, users who sign-up their trial accounts could try the games until the beta tests end before Quarter 3 of this year for free. Meanwhile, there are also “paid” full account that is either $2.49 for 1 month, $8.99 for three months, and $24 for 1 year.

Chesspark is based in Florida, and they’re actively involved in sponsor organizations such as Be Someone and Hip-Hop Chess Federation.
